Why is Kaira Can Company Ltd ?
1
Poor long term growth as Operating profit has grown by an annual rate -6.89% of over the last 5 years
2
Flat results in Sep 25
- OPERATING CF(Y) Lowest at Rs -1.19 Cr
- PBT LESS OI(Q) Lowest at Rs 0.49 cr.
- EPS(Q) Lowest at Rs 4.35
3
With ROE of 4.4, it has a Expensive valuation with a 1.6 Price to Book Value
- The stock is trading at a premium compared to its peers' average historical valuations
- Over the past year, while the stock has generated a return of -20.15%, its profits have risen by 34.2% ; the PEG ratio of the company is 1.1
4
Consistent Underperformance against the benchmark over the last 3 years
- Along with generating -20.15% returns in the last 1 year, the stock has also underperformed BSE500 in each of the last 3 annual periods
